Two Chinese women collapse in street after arguing non-stop for eight hours

Neither one ate or drank the entire time on a scorching day before they were taken to hospital

Two women in Northwest China fainted from exhaustion after quarrelling with each other for eight hours without eating or drinking, according to local media reports.

The two middle-aged women, who were not named, became embroiled in a heated argument on a street in Ankang, Shaanxi province last Tuesday, the Xian-based Chinese Business View reported.

Police said the two were arguing over the settlement of a debt.

The women called the police at one point, but rejected an officer’s suggestion that they settle the dispute in court.

Both women fainted on the street when the police returned to the scene eight hours later. One of them was foaming at the mouth and was incontinent.

Neither woman ate or drank anything during the entire dispute, the police said, and the weather that day was very hot.

Both women were sent to a local hospital, and were in stable condition.
